               Stewart Chosen SAC Softball Player Of The Week

ROCK HILL, S.C. –
Presbyterian College’s Erin Stewart was chosen as the South Atlantic Conference’s Player of the Week it was announced by the conference office on Monday.

Stewart hit .500 for the Lady Blue Hose last week, going 4-for-8 from the plate in PC’s 4-0 week.

The Marion, S.C. native collected two of her four hits on the first two home runs of her career with both home runs serving as game winners for PC.

The sophomore acquired the first home run of her career in game two of a twinbill with USC Aiken on Tuesday, March 20 at the PC Softball Complex. The two-run shot proved to be all the offense the Lady Blue Hose would need in the 2-0 victory over the Lady Pacers.

The Marion High School product’s second home run of the week and her career came against Catawba in PC’s game one win over the Indians on Saturday, March 24. The score 1-0 in favor of Presbyterian, Stewart hit a home run in the bottom of the second inning to place PC ahead for good at 2-0 in the eventual 2-1 Lady Blue Hose win.

The South Atlantic Conference Player of the Week is voted on by the Sports Information Directors of the nine member schools.
